JavaScript로 JSON 파일 다운로드

브라우저만으로 API를 두드리고 JSON 파일을 얻는 방법입니다.
d3.js를 사용하는 것은 취미이므로, jQuery로 취득해도 단순한 JavaScript로 취득해도 좋다고 생각합니다.

코드를 수정하면 API를 여러 번 두드려 JSON을 결합하여 마지막으로 다운로드 할 수 있습니다.
단지 파일명이 반드시 다운로드가 되므로, 어떻게든 되지 않을까~라고 생각하고 있습니다.


  //JSONファイルの読み込み
  d3.json(url,function(data){
     //JSONデータをURLに変換
    var href = "data:application/octet-stream," + encodeURIComponent(JSON.stringify(data));

    //URLを叩き、ダウンロード
    location.href = href;
    return true;
  });

좋은 웹페이지 즐겨찾기